Electrical discharge machining is assessed on the basis of Material Removal Rate (MRR), Tool Wear Rate (TWR), and Surface Roughness (SR). Process parameters that mostly affected the EDM Process are Pulse on Time, Pulse off Time, Discharge Current, Arc Gap and Duty Cycle. In this paper, a hybrid Taguchi-immune algorithm (HTIA) is presented to deal with the unit commitment problem. HTIA integrates the Taguchi method and the traditional immune algorithm (TIA), providing a powerful global exploration capability.
